Precision Temperature Control for Beverage Integrity

Single-zone refrigeration offers a broad temperature range, typically from 37°F to 65°F (3°C to 18°C). This precision is vital for beverage preservation. As noted on Wikipedia’s refrigerator entry, maintaining a consistent, appropriate temperature slows the growth of spoilage bacteria and preserves flavor. Different beverages have ideal serving temperatures; lagers are best at 38°F (3°C), while many ales and ciders are better at 45-50°F (7-10°C). A unit with a wide, adjustable range allows users to cater to these specifics, ensuring drinks are stored at their perfect temperature, not merely a cold one.

Engineered for Efficiency and Discreet Operation

Modern beverage coolers integrate advanced compressor technology to achieve energy efficiency and quiet operation. A noise level of 38 decibels, quieter than a standard library, is a significant design consideration for open-concept living spaces. This focus on low-noise operation aligns with user priorities in home entertainment forums. Furthermore, energy-efficient compressors reduce operational costs. This technology leverages improved heat exchange and better insulation materials, principles outlined in refrigeration engineering resources, to maintain performance while minimizing power consumption—a key feature for an appliance that often runs continuously.
